            Kana Vinaka Cookbook wins at Gourmand World Cookbook Awards 2018

            June 14, 2018

            Contemporary island cuisine cookbook, Kana Vinaka was awarded the winner in the Best South Pacific Food Culture category at the Gourmand World Cookbook Awards 2018.

            “As the sole entry from Fiji and the Pacific amongst 215 countries and regions, this is a wonderful recognition and a testament that we can do contemporary style cuisine in the Pacific using the abundant supply of fresh local produce,” said renowned chef and author, Colin Chung.

            The cookbook which was launched in April 2017 “has simple recipes and concepts and shows the importance on what people at home can do with local produce,” said Mr Chung.

            He added that “It really makes a difference if we ate local as opposed to imported goods and made correct choices even at home. We should stay away from processed food and if we do that there wouldn’t be so many non-communicable diseases (NCDs) which is rife in the Pacific, and that makes a difference.”

            The awards took place from May 26 -27, 2018 in Yantai, China.
